Extraordinary Experiences That Changed Lives. Dan Millman with Doug Childers
Before he wrote his contemporary spiritual classics, a 1966 motorcycle crash shattered the leg and ended the Olympic dreams of young gymnast Dan Millman. Twelve years later, two thugs, one armed with a metal pipe, closed in to attack young writer Doug Childers. As each chapter of this richly diverse collection (first published as "Divine Interventions") attests, many of our life stories contain experiences that build bridges to a higher reality, expand awareness, and provide profound spiritual insight. These stories, from the past and the present, of the famous (including Joan of Arc, Carl Jung, and Muhammad) and the little known, inspire hope and awaken a sense of reverence, wonder, and awe. They invite believers and skeptics of every stripe to witness phenomena that embrace, rather than defy, both faith and reason.
